Actress Julie Bowen talks to Hoda and Jenna about the Happy Gilmore sequel and new cast members Bad Bunny and Travis Kelce! She also talks about the fun side of raising her three teenage boys. “They told me I was 'crazy about a waiter' once,” she recalls.
